Answer:

So m=-14

Step-by-step explanation:

First, you distribute the 3 with -3 and 4m which is -9 and 12m

Now the equation looks like this:

13m=-9+12m-5

Add -9 and -5 which is -14

13m=-14+12m

Move the 12m to the other side by subtracting 12m on both sides:

13m-12m=-14+12m-12m

m=-14
